What “AI video enhancer” actually means (and why it’s confusing)
“AI video enhancer” is a broad term. In practice, it covers several different problems that often get mixed together: upscaling resolution, removing noise, fixing blur, stabilizing shaky footage, and restoring compressed or old videos.
Most tools don’t do all of these equally well. Some are strong at upscaling but weak at motion stabilization. Others clean noise but introduce artifacts in faces or text. That’s why choosing the best ai video enhancer is not just about picking the most popular tool. It’s about matching the tool to the exact problem in your footage.

How to choose the right AI video enhancer
Choosing the right ai video enhancer is less about “which tool is best” and more about identifying what is actually wrong with your footage. Most videos don’t fail for the same reason. Some are noisy, some are blurry, some are compressed, and others are just low resolution. Each issue requires a different type of processing, and using the wrong tool often makes the result worse instead of better.
Start by identifying the primary problem, not the tool. If your video looks soft but stable, you are likely dealing with resolution limits, so an image upscaler or video upscaling model is the right direction. If the footage looks grainy, especially in low light, then denoise video ai tools will give you the biggest improvement. If motion looks smeared or unclear, then deblur video ai models are more relevant. These are not interchangeable, and many tools specialize in only one or two of these areas.
Next, consider how much quality you actually need. If you are restoring archival footage or working on professional edits, tools like Topaz Video AI or DaVinci Resolve make more sense because they prioritize reconstruction accuracy. However, if you are producing content for social media, speed and convenience matter more than perfect detail. In that case, tools like Magic Hour or CapCut are often the better choice because they deliver “good enough” quality much faster.
Workflow is another deciding factor that people often overlook. If your process involves multiple steps like image to video, talking photo, or lipsync, then a tool that integrates these features will save time and reduce friction. Magic Hour is strong here because enhancement is just one part of a larger system. In contrast, tools like AVCLabs or Topaz are more isolated, which means more exporting and reprocessing between steps.
You should also think about scale. If you are handling a large volume of videos, batch processing becomes critical. AVCLabs is designed for this, while tools like Premiere Pro or DaVinci Resolve require more manual work. On the other hand, if you are working on a single high-value video, manual control might be worth the extra time.
Finally, always test before committing. Take a short 10–20 second clip that represents your real problem and run it through two or three tools. Look closely at faces, motion, and fine details like text or edges. Pay attention to whether the tool introduces artifacts or unnatural smoothing. This quick test will tell you more than any feature list and helps you avoid choosing a tool based on assumptions.
What to test in 5 minutes (quick evaluation method)
A quick test is the fastest way to avoid choosing the wrong ai video enhancer. You don’t need full projects or long exports. A short, representative clip is enough to reveal how a tool actually behaves.
Start with a 10–20 second sample that contains your real issue. If your footage is noisy, pick a dark scene. If it’s blurry, choose a segment with motion. If it’s compressed, include areas with gradients or fast movement. Avoid “clean” clips because they hide problems and make every tool look good.
Run the same clip through 2–3 tools using similar settings. Do not rely on default outputs alone. If possible, test one pass for denoise video ai, one for upscaling, and one combined. This helps you understand how each tool handles different stages instead of assuming an all-in-one result will work.
When reviewing outputs, focus on faces first. Human faces expose problems quickly, especially if you plan to use outputs for face swap, talking photo, or headshot generator workflows. Look for waxy skin, distorted features, or unnatural sharpening. These are common failure modes.
Next, check motion consistency. Play the clip at normal speed and then frame-by-frame. Watch for flickering, ghosting, or inconsistent detail between frames. Tools that look sharp in a still frame can break apart during motion, especially in deblur video ai scenarios.
Then evaluate fine details. Look at text, edges, and high-frequency areas like hair or patterns. A good ai video restoration tool should improve clarity without introducing ringing artifacts or over-sharpening. If details look artificially “crunchy,” the model is likely overcompensating.
Also compare file size and export quality. Some tools improve visuals but compress the output aggressively. If you plan to reuse the footage in editing software or pipelines like image editor or image to video workflows, this matters more than it seems.
Finally, check processing time versus output gain. If a tool takes significantly longer but only gives a minor improvement, it may not be worth using at scale. This is especially important if you plan batch processing or frequent edits.

Can AI fully restore old videos?
AI can significantly improve quality, but it cannot recreate missing data perfectly. Results depend heavily on the source footage.
